How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 23504?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 23504 Studio Apartments | $1,770 | $1,499 | $1,890 |
| 23504 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,477 | $710 | $2,228 |
| 23504 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,907 | $810 | $3,247 |
| 23504 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,173 | $1,075 | $3,777 |
| 23504 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,588 | $1,200 | $2,627 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ly the 23504 ZIP Code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ly 23504 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in 23504 is $1,305.
What is the largest Pet Friendly 23504 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in 23504 is a 2,572 square feet unit starting from $979 at Euclid Apartments.
What is the average size for 23504 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in 23504 is currently at 667 sq ft.
